Kinds Of Sofa Shops in the UK
When looking for the perfect sofa, consumers can pick from different types of sofa stores, each providing unique advantages and styles:

National Retail Chains: These are large furniture retailers with numerous areas throughout the UK, such as DFS, IKEA, and John Lewis. They typically offer a large selection of sofas varying from budget-friendly to high-end choices.

Store Sofa Shops: Smaller, independent stores like Sofa.com or Munro Interiors focus on workmanship and personalized service. These stores might offer bespoke furniture, allowing consumers to personalize designs, materials, and sizes.

Online Retailers: The rise of e-commerce has offered birth to a variety of online sofa retailers like Wayfair, Made.com, and Swoon. Online shopping uses convenience and typically competitive rates, although clients lose out on the tactile experience of in-store shopping.

Second-Hand Shops: Places like eBay, Facebook Marketplace, and local charity shops offer an avenue for budget-conscious consumers looking for special or vintage pieces. A frequently cost-effective option, buying pre-owned can cause sustainability benefits as well.

Custom Furniture Makers: For those seeking completely distinct pieces, custom-made furniture makers permit overall design control, although this frequently comes at a premium cost.
Popular Styles of Sofas in the UK
Sofas are available in various styles that show style patterns and deal with various lifestyles. Comprehending these can aid in choosing the right piece for a home:

Chesterfield: Recognizable by their classic tufted style, Chesterfield sofas are typically upholstered in leather couch uk. They add a touch of sophistication and charm to standard interiors.

Sectional Sofas: Known for versatility, sectional sofas are designed to fit bigger spaces and can be reorganized to match the design of a space.

Sleeper Sofas: Ideal for smaller homes or guest rooms, sleeper sofas function as both seating and beds, offering practicality without compromising style.

Mid-Century Modern: Characterized by clean lines and practical style, these sofas are best for those who choose a minimalist visual.

Scandinavian Design: Emphasizing simplicity and minimalism while taking full advantage of function, Scandinavian sofas often include light woods and neutral materials, ideal for modern home.
Elements to Consider When Buying a Sofa
Getting a sofa is a financial investment that requires cautious consideration. Here are some vital elements to bear in mind:

Size: Before going to a store or shopping online, measure the area where the sofa will live. Guaranteeing it complements the space's scale prevents a confined or out of proportion look.

Material: Sofas can be found in numerous materials, consisting of leather, cotton, and synthetic materials. Each product has its own advantages in terms of resilience, upkeep, and design.

Convenience: The sofa's convenience level is paramount. Clients must take the time to rest on various models to discover the one that feels right for them.

Style: The sofa ought to balance with existing design. Whether choosing contemporary, standard, or diverse design styles, ensure it complements the total aesthetic of the room.

Budget: Sofas differ significantly in cost, and setting a budget prior to shopping helps limit choices while preventing impulse purchases.

Functionality: Consider lifestyle requirements. Families with children and family pets may need long lasting materials that are easy to tidy, while others may prioritize visual appeals over usefulness.
